Serendipity Capital Invests in Australian-Based Emergence Quantum
Capital is moving toward the engineering bottlenecks of the quantum sector. Serendipity Capital has entered a strategic partnership with Emergence Quantum that includes a significant investment intended to expand advanced computing ventures and products.
The agreement merges the technical expertise of Emergence Quantum in quantum engineering and cryogenic computing with the investment capabilities, technical due diligence resources, and global partner network of Serendipity Capital. This partnership aims to establish new strategic companies and products across the advanced computing sector.
Emergence Quantum launched in 2025 and was revenue positive from day one. The company has grown through bootstrapping while supporting a large and highly-skilled team of 25, most of whom hold PhDs. This financial position allowed the company to be selective in choosing a partner that aligns with its long-term perspective.
This deal signifies a shift toward integrating deep technical know-how with institutional investment muscle. For Serendipity Capital, the partnership deepens technical capability across quantum technologies and cryogenic computing, specifically for applications in semiconductors and other areas of advanced computing. For Emergence Quantum, the capital provides the means to accelerate work with customers and partners worldwide while maintaining its technical independence.
The success of this venture depends on whether the combined resources can effectively translate cryogenic computing expertise into scalable commercial products. Watch for how this partnership uses its new capacity for company formation to introduce new players to the quantum ecosystem.
